Zero Sum Dev Log #5 - School's back!
In "Problem Sets" you can create your own math puzzles with a lot of freedom, then get a code to share it and let anyone play it. Once they are done they get a result code to send back to you and you can collect and compare results of all of them. Perfect to create your own math puzzles and teach math in a fun way. Zero Sum Dev Log #3 - Modulo, the player's nuke
There's a 960 on screen. It's angry, it's TANKY and your minus does 1 damage. You could be here all day. Or you could fire one %80 and watch it solve all your problems. Modulo replaces a number with the remainder after division. 960 divided by 80 is exactly 12, remainder zero. Zero Sum Demo Playable During Steam Next Fest!
Gear up for some raw arithmetic violence ! In Zero Sum , every bullet is an equation and every enemy is a number. No health bars. No hit points. Just pure mathematical combat in a hand-drawn twin-stick shooter that looks like your math notebook came to life and got angry.
